-
公开(公告)号:US11467921B2
公开(公告)日:2022-10-11
申请号:US16886488
申请日:2020-05-28
Applicant: EMC IP Holding Company LLC
Inventor: Shelesh Chopra , Sunil Yadav , Amarendra Behera , Himanshu Arora , Tushar Dethe , Sapna Chauhan , Anjana Rao , Deependra Pratap Singh , Jigar Premajibhai Bhanushali , Ravi V. Chitloor
Abstract: A system for providing backup services for limited-access user data includes persistent storage for storing a user data visualization enhanced user data backup and a manager. The manager identifies a backup generation event for limited-access user data based on a protection policy; in response to identifying the backup generation event, obtains fragmented user data from an application that gates access to the limited-access user data; obtains organizational metadata associated with the fragmented user data from the application; makes a determination that the fragmented user data is associated with a user data visualization; in response to making the determination, obtains user data visualization metadata associated with the fragmented user data from the application; and generates the user data enhanced user data backup using the organizational metadata, the user data visualization metadata, and the fragmented user data.
-
12.
公开(公告)号:US11442822B1
公开(公告)日:2022-09-13
申请号:US17229170
申请日:2021-04-13
Applicant: EMC IP Holding Company LLC
Inventor: Shelesh Chopra , Sunil Yadav , Amarendra Behera , Ravi Vijayakumar Chitloor , Himanshu Arora , Tushar Dethe , Deependra Singh , Prabhat Kumar Dubey , Anjana Rao , Sapna Chauhan
Abstract: In some embodiments, described is a system (and method) for providing an efficient preview capability for emails backed up to a cloud-based object storage. The email preview may be provided as part of an interface allowing a user to select individual emails to restore from the object storage. The system may extract specialized preview information as part of a backup procedure. The preview information may include metadata and email content. For example, the preview information may include various email details such as sender, receiver, subject line, time sent/received, filenames of any attachments, etc. The preview information may also include email content such as particular sentences from the email body containing keywords. The system may also store extracted preview information in a specialized manner such that the preview information may be retrieved without having to access the actual backup data.
-
13.
公开(公告)号:US11442819B2
公开(公告)日:2022-09-13
申请号:US17150199
申请日:2021-01-15
Applicant: EMC IP Holding Company LLC
Inventor: Shelesh Chopra , Sunil Yadav , Amarendra Behera , Ravi Vijayakumar Chitloor , Himanshu Arora , Tushar Dethe , Jigar Bhanushali , Deependra Singh , Prabhat Kumar Dubey
IPC: G06F11/14
Abstract: Described is a system (and method) for managing specialized metadata that may be used to manage and search incremental backup data stored on a cloud-based object storage. The system may create and store such metadata as part of a specialized metadata database that includes a data catalog and a backup catalog. The system may leverage the metadata database to initiate operations to efficiently manage incremental backup data stored on the object storage. For example, the metadata may be relied upon to efficiently reconstruct (e.g. synthetically) the client data to a point-in-time of any incremental backup. In addition, the metadata may include properties of the backed-up data, which are maintained separately from the backup data stored as objects. Accordingly, these properties may be searched to identify and locate backup data without having to retrieve the stored objects.
-
14.
公开(公告)号:US20220229735A1
公开(公告)日:2022-07-21
申请号:US17150199
申请日:2021-01-15
Applicant: EMC IP Holding Company LLC
Inventor: Shelesh Chopra , Sunil Yadav , Amarendra Behera , Ravi Vijayakumar Chitloor , Himanshu Arora , Tushar Dethe , Jigar Bhanushali , Deependra Singh , Prabhat Kumar Dubey
IPC: G06F11/14
Abstract: Described is a system (and method) for managing specialized metadata that may be used to manage and search incremental backup data stored on a cloud-based object storage. The system may create and store such metadata as part of a specialized metadata database that includes a data catalog and a backup catalog. The system may leverage the metadata database to initiate operations to efficiently manage incremental backup data stored on the object storage. For example, the metadata may be relied upon to efficiently reconstruct (e.g. synthetically) the client data to a point-in-time of any incremental backup. In addition, the metadata may include properties of the backed-up data, which are maintained separately from the backup data stored as objects. Accordingly, these properties may be searched to identify and locate backup data without having to retrieve the stored objects.
-
公开(公告)号:US20220214946A1
公开(公告)日:2022-07-07
申请号:US17140855
申请日:2021-01-04
Applicant: EMC IP Holding Company LLC
Inventor: Sunil Yadav , Shelesh Chopra , Amarendra Behera , Tushar Dethe , Himanshu Arora , Deependra Singh , Jigar Bhanushali , Prabhat Kumar Dubey , Ravi Vijayakumar Chitloor
Abstract: Described is a system for managing backup data stored on a cloud-based object storage irrespective of the storage provider. The system may include a server (or gateway) that provides a backup service, and acts as an intermediary between a client device and object storage. To provide such capabilities, the system may manage an application programming interface (API) that provides a uniform set of methods to a client device irrespective of the destination object storage provider. A function library may include provider-specific functions that invoke corresponding storage-layer operations provided by the destination object storage. The server may also manage an operation pool to schedule operations and saturate bandwidth to the object storage. The server may also implement a specialized metadata database to provide further storage efficiencies by storing certain backup data exclusively within the metadata database.
-
16.
公开(公告)号:US11340824B1
公开(公告)日:2022-05-24
申请号:US17141475
申请日:2021-01-05
Applicant: EMC IP Holding Company LLC
Inventor: Sunil Yadav , Ravi Vijayakumar Chitloor , Shelesh Chopra , Amarendra Behera , Tushar Dethe , Jigar Bhanushali , Deependra Singh , Himanshu Arora , Prabhat Kumar Dubey
IPC: G06F3/06 , H04L67/1097 , G06F16/23
Abstract: Described is a system (and method) for efficient object storage management when backing up data to a cloud-based object storage. The system may be implemented as part of a server (or gateway) that provides a backup service to a client device by acting as an intermediary when backing up data from the client device to a third-party cloud-based object storage. The system may implement various specialized procedures to efficiently store backup data as objects within the object storage. The procedures may include packing client data into objects of a consistent size to improve storage performance. The system may also improve storage performance and conserve storage by analyzing the data stored within an object and reallocating the data as necessary. More particularly, the system may efficiently reallocate data to new objects when the amount of live data within an object falls below a predetermined threshold.
-
17.
公开(公告)号:US20210191821A1
公开(公告)日:2021-06-24
申请号:US16886466
申请日:2020-05-28
Applicant: EMC IP Holding Company LLC
Inventor: Sunil Yadav , Shelesh Chopra , Tushar Dethe , Jigar Premajibhai Bhanushali , Sapna Chauhan , Deependra Pratap Singh , Himanshu Arora , Anjana Rao , Amarendra Behera , Ravi V. Chitloor
IPC: G06F11/14
Abstract: A system for providing backup services for limited-access user data includes persistent storage for storing a conversation specific user data backup and a manager. The manager identifies a backup generation event for limited-access user data based on a protection policy; in response to identifying the backup generation event; obtains fragmented user data from an application that gates access to the limited-access user data; obtains organizational metadata associated with the fragmented user data from the application; makes a determination that the fragmented user data is associated with a conversation; in response to making the determination, obtains conversation metadata associated with the fragmented user data from the application; and generates the conversation specific user data backup using the organizational metadata, conversation metadata, and the fragmented user data.
-
公开(公告)号:US20210133044A1
公开(公告)日:2021-05-06
申请号:US16672303
申请日:2019-11-01
Applicant: EMC IP Holding Company LLC
Inventor: Asif Khan , Amith Ramachandran , Amarendra Behera , Deepika Nagabushanam , Ashish Kumar , Pati Mohan , Tushar Dethe , Himanshu Arora , Gururaj Soma , Sapna Chauhan , Soumen Acharya , Reshmee Jawed , Yasemin Ugur-Ozekinci , Shelesh Chopra , Navneet Upadhyay , Shraddha Chunekar
Abstract: A backup manager for managing backup services includes persistent storage and a backup analyzer. The persistent storage includes a backup data repository and protection policies. The backup analyzer identifies a new backup stored in backup storage; performs a backup compatibility analysis on the new backup to determine inter-backup compatibility of the identified new backup; updates the backup data repository based on the inter-backup compatibility to obtain an updated backup data repository; and modifies a backup schedule using the updated backup data repository to meet a requirement of a protection policy of the protection policies.
-
公开(公告)号:US10860427B1
公开(公告)日:2020-12-08
申请号:US15390392
申请日:2016-12-23
Applicant: EMC IP Holding Company LLC
Inventor: Anupam Chakraborty , Sunil Yadav , Satyendra Nath Sharma , Soumen Acharya , Tushar Dethe , Upanshu Singhal
IPC: G06F11/14
Abstract: A cluster includes cluster shared volumes and nodes. A subset of the nodes are designated as being backup proxy nodes responsible for backing up the cluster shared volumes. The cluster shared volumes are divided into groups, each group having a number of cluster shared volumes that is less than a total number of cluster shared volumes in the cluster. Generation is initiated for a particular snapshot for a number of cluster shared volumes belonging to a particular group. The backup proxy nodes backup data from the particular cluster shared volumes belong to the particular group using the particular snapshot. After the backup, the steps initiating snapshot generation and backing up are repeated until each group of cluster shared volumes has been backed up.
-
公开(公告)号:US10664357B1
公开(公告)日:2020-05-26
申请号:US15384998
申请日:2016-12-20
Applicant: EMC IP Holding Company LLC
Inventor: Shubhashish Mallik , Tushar Dethe , Anupam Chakraborty
Abstract: Embodiments are directed to a method of backing up virtual machines coupled to a backup server in a large-scale data storage system, by installing a single instance of a backup management program on the backup server; pushing, by the backup management program, a backup agent to each virtual machine; detecting, through the backup agent, all applications running on a respective virtual machine; taking a snapshot of each application after freezing the applications and prior to thawing the applications, by the backup agent; and saving the snapshot of the each applications on a storage medium. The pushing step comprises creating a shared folder and exposing the shared folder to all the virtual machines for remote invocation by the backup program.
-
-
-
-
-
-
-
-
-